Full Job Description
Job Summary:
Provides functional direction and acts as a resource for problem solving in the absence of Chief Engineer or as directed. Operates and maintains all plant operations equipment including all boilers, chillers, and HVAC systems. Operates and maintains all auxiliary equipment necessary to the operation of the medical center and all outlying clinics, such as pumps, motors, and compressors. Operates all machines and equipment vital to performing of maintenance and repair. Performs water treatment analysis and makes all adjustments as necessary.
Essential Responsibilities:
  • Upholds Kaiser Permanentes Policies and Procedures, Principles of Responsibilities and applicable state, federal and local laws. Provides functional direction and acts as a resource for problem solving in absence of Chief Engineer or as directed. Under indirect supervision, inservices and trains staff members as appropriate. Assists supervisor with various duties to include input to operational procedures, gathering statistics, and providing input in performance evaluations. Operates, maintains, inspects and performs repairs and mechanical alterations to manual and automatic gas and oil fired high pressure steam or high temperature hot water boilers. Operates, maintains, inspects and makes repairs to motors, steam reducing stations, expansion tanks, air compressors, supply and exhaust fans, pumps and valves, steam caps, water treatment systems, water heaters and related auxiliary equipment. Adjusts, maintains and tests boiler and air conditioning/refrigeration machinery, and all mechanical, electrical or pneumatic control instruments. Maintains safety devices and makes adjustments as necessary. Performs electrical repairs such as bed lamps, non-complex electrical devices, changing ballasts, repairs electrical line cords, fixing light switches, isolating electrical problems and replacing fuses. Conducts electrical safety test on equipment, electrical plugs and outlets. Unclogs pipes and plumbing fixtures and related equipment as necessary. Tests boiler, water, cooling tower water, and water from all other systems. Adds chemicals and makes appropriate adjustments as dictated by control parameters. Performs routine repairs on such equipment as cart washers, sterilizers, oxygen, air outlets, suction pumps, hospital beds, sinks, toilets and other associated hospital plant equipment. Completes work assignments to include routine installations of plant equipment, hanging of signs and pictures, adjusting and maintaining time clocks.
  • Determines type and extent of equipment malfunction, adjusting, disassembling, repairing or replacing of parts and components; reassembles and tests equipment for safe and proper operation. Ability to read blueprints, schematics, single line diagram and repair manuals. Performs preventative maintenance to include cleaning, oiling, painting, calibration and other related duties to extend the life cycle of equipment, or to maintain a clean, safe, hygienic environmental work area. Through on the job training assists skilled maintenance persons in trade tasks in which employee is not certified. Observes, takes readings, evaluates gauges and meters determining operating conditions, regulating equipment to control the operations in accordance with the needs of the medical center and all outlying clinics, existing state codes and safety standards. Cleans or oversees the cleaning of boilers and their associated machinery and equipment to include water towers, D.A. tanks. Records operating data in the appropriate logs. Isolates electrical problems related to plant industrial equipment and makes repairs as necessary. Repairs and maintains air conditioning and refrigeration equipment to include related electrical circuit analysis. Troubleshoots and repairs related equipment to include but not limited to thermostats, ice machines, humidifiers, air dampers and other related or associated equipment. Repair or modify equipment or plant structures by welding using both electrical or oxygen acetylene equipment, cuts, braces and solders all types of metal materials.
